Address

NTbZ4owXRwAiwdrndEqJFtRT7DbUZH7DNa

0 XNA

Confirmed
Total Received0.89368495 XNA
Total Sent0.89368495 XNA
Final Balance0 XNA
No. Transactions2

Transactions

NTbZ4owXRwAiwdrndEqJFtRT7DbUZH7DNa0.89368495 XNA
 
 
NTbZ4owXRwAiwdrndEqJFtRT7DbUZH7DNa0.89368495 XNA